#e02cda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e02cda is composed of 87.8% red, 17.3%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.4% magenta, 2.7%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 302 degrees, a saturation of 74.4% and a lightness of 52.5%. #e02cda color hex could be obtained by blending #ff58ff with #c100b5.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#e02cda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e02cda has RGB values of R:224, G:44,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.8, Y:0.03,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14691546.

Shades and Tints of #e02cda
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b020b is the darkest color, while #fef9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e02cda
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c808c is the less saturated color, while #fc10f4 is the most saturated one.
